How To Build a Mini Nuc Bee Box

Image
What you will need: 5 ' long- 12" wide- 1" thick plank of wood Pencil Saw Hammer Ruler/Carpenter square Safety Glasses Wood Glue Finishing Nails (about 30) 1.5" Velcro Frames (6) - purchased online Brad nails 5/8 Dimensions: Top 14" X 12" Bottom 9 3/4" X 12 1/4" Side (2) 8" X 11 1/4" Back  8" X 11 1/4" Front 11 1/4" X 6" Rails 2 X 11"-- 3/4" deep Frames 9 1/4" X 6 1/2" X 1 1/2" Step 1: Measure! Measure out all the dimensions above with a carpenter square, tape measure, or ruler and trace with a pencil. A carpenter Square helps keep the lines true and makes a 90 degree angle cuts so all the pieces fit together perfectly. Step 2: Cut! Saw the wood where you traced the line. What is The Bee Mindful Project?

Image
The Bee Mindful Project came about at the beginning of 2017 when I begun my Girl Scout Gold Award service project. If you didn't already know, the Gold Award is the highest level achievement in the Girl Scouts. In order to receive the award, you must find a problem in your community and try and solve it with a minimum of 80 service hours. Those who receive this award have many opportunities for scholarships and an advantage when applying to colleges. So, not only does this service project give back and help the community, but it also helps girls further their academic future. When researching about what topic I was going to choose for my project back in February, I remembered in the recent news that a bumblebee species had been put on the endangered species list for the first time in the United States.
